Output d61f87860ade397d33f9b2373529672f60caff8a41e8960b5c9329c0d7a10d21:22

value
1055975
script pubkey
OP_0 OP_PUSHBYTES_20 d3d99f172e0f1294f5145b8c1b9524179694e3e3
address
bc1q60ve79ewpufffag5twxph9fyz7tffclr9kdw0j
transaction
d61f87860ade397d33f9b2373529672f60caff8a41e8960b5c9329c0d7a10d21
spent
true